Pecan Waffles with Caramelized Bananas
Source of Recipe
Gourmet, February 2000
List of Ingredients
- 1 cup all-purpose flour
- 1/2 cup pecans, toasted and finely chopped
- 1 tsp baking powder
- 1/4 tsp baking soda
- 1/2 tsp salt
- 1 cup well-shaken buttermilk
- 1 stick unsalted butter, melted
- 1 large egg, lightly beaten
- 3 large firm-ripe bananas
- 3/4 cup sugar

- Accompaniment: warm honey
Instructions
- Preheat oven to 250 degrees (F) and preheat (a well-seasoned or nonstick) waffle iron. Whisk together flour, pecans, baking powder, baking soda and salt. Stir in buttermilk, 6 tablespoons of the butter and egg until smooth. (Batter will be thick.)
- Spoon batter into waffle iron, using half of the batter for 4 (4-inch) standard waffles and spreading batter evenly; cook according to manufacturer's directions. Transfer waffles to a baking sheet and keep warm, uncovered, in middle of oven. Make more waffles in same manner.
- Halve bananas crosswise and then lengthwise. Roll bananas in sugar to coat. Heat remaining 2 tablespoons butter in a large nonstick skillet over moderately high heat until foam subsides, then saute bananas, starting with cut sides down and turning once, until golden brown. Transfer bananas with a spatula to an oiled baking sheet and cool slightly.
Put 4 waffles on 4 plates and divide bananas among them. Top bananas with remaining waffles.
Serves 4
